NoDrip: The Perfect Gadget for Eating Ice Cream this Summer

Fit this plastic bowl around the base of your popsicle to stop your hands from getting sticky when it starts to melt. This is a must-have summer gadget for ice cream and popsicle lovers.

Who hasn't gotten sticky, gooey ice cream all over themselves at least once? When it's really hot out, it's almost impossibly not to get your hands dirty while eating ice cream pops. NoDrip will put an end to this disaster and, although the gadget is designed to prevent kids from getting ice cream all over themselves, no doubt more than one adult will want to give it a try.

NoDrip is a Swedish invention and it's as simple as a little bowl with a hole in the middle. All you have to do is insert the popsicle stick in the hole at the bottom of the bowl! It appears this invention has been a huge success and there are now several different versions available.

Our favorite is Sip-A-Pop, a mold you can use to make ice cream pops that not only protects you from that sticky melted goo, but also has a built-in straw so you can drink the "ice cream juice" that's accumulated inside the bowl. It's simply genius.
